How do I change my KRA KYC online?
In case of any change in KYC details, please submit a change request form along with the supporting documents with any broker, DP, mutual fund etc. with whom you transact. On verification of the same, CVL will download the updated details to all intermediaries which have registered your KYC.

How do I correct my KYC address?
To update your mutual fund KYC, you will have to fill ‘KYC details change’ form. You can get this form from the website of mutual funds and registrar and transfer agents (RTA) such as CAMS and K-Fin. Self-attested copy of PAN is a must with all KYC updation forms.

What is IPV flag y in KYC?
IPV refers to In-Person Verification, and it is a new prerequisite for mutual fund investors. To do this, your AMC will re-validate the KYC info you submitted online. You either need to physically meet the official representative from the fund house or distributor with all the original documents.

How can I register my KYC online?
Online KYC with KRA
- Log on to the website of any KYC Registered Agency.
- Create an account and fill in all the details on the online form.
- You will have to provide your registered mobile number, PAN Card and other identification details.
- Upload self attested documents online.
How is KYC full form?
KYC means Know Your Customer and sometimes Know Your Client. KYC or KYC check is the mandatory process of identifying and verifying the client’s identity when opening an account and periodically over time. In other words, banks must make sure that their clients are genuinely who they claim to be.
